/*
 * Reconciliation client for the Pallet-Truth nightly job.
 * This connects to the internal Binwise Count API and pulls
 * staged inventory deltas for the Frostmere and Caldren depots.
 * If the job stalls, check Binwise first — it rate-limits at
 * 50 req/s and silently queues beyond that. Retries are handled
 * upstream; do not add retry logic here. The client requires a
 * static key passed at construction time. Use the key that follows.
 */

gateway credential: kto3_qfe

Runbook: Scanline barcode bridge

If warehouse scans stop flowing into Cartwheel, it's almost always the bridge service on the Dunmore floor box wedging after a USB hiccup. Bounce the service first — nine times out of ten that fixes it. If not, check the queue depth before escalating. When restarting, make sure the bridge comes up with these settings.

deployment values, yafop-bajef:
[gilok]
team = ulaius
access_code = ac_423664
host = gilok.sivrelhq.corp
port = 9200
owner = pelius.istax
peer = eliok.torvasoft.internal

TilePull account recovery — release manager procedure. Applies when the prefetcher's service account is locked mid-release and tile warming halts. Do not re-provision the account; that invalidates queued prefetch jobs. Instead, restore from the escrow vault: confirm the lockout in the scheduler log, open the vault console, and select the TilePull service identity. The console prompts once for the standing recovery passphrase. Enter it exactly as recorded below.

unlock words, hahip-yagef: zorok-novmir-zorix-silax

Fan-out backpressure for the Quillet notifier: when the queue depth crosses the soft limit, the dispatcher sheds low-priority pushes and batches the rest at 500ms intervals. Reviewer should confirm the shed counter is exported and that retries respect the jitter window. Once merged, the release artifact gets re-signed by the pipeline, which expects the deploy key shown below.

deploy key for bawep-yawif: bky6_GQhaSt